Alligator Point is located 45 miles south of Tallahassee along US
Hwy. 98 in Franklin County. Franklin County proudly boasts that it
has no stop lights, no fast food, and no movie theaters. If you are
looking for water parks, high rise condos, and go-cart rides, you
have come to the wrong place. But if you want the REAL FLORIDA,
with its abundant wildlife, great fishing and unspoiled, pristine
beaches, you have arrived at your dream destination.

Within a few minutes drive are two of the nation�s TOP TEN RATED
BEACHES, St. George Island State Park, near Apalachicola, and St.
Joseph Peninsula State Park, near Port St. Joe. Both parks contain
miles of undeveloped beaches, emerald waters and white sugar sand.
Other nearby attractions include St. Vincent National Wildlife
Refuge, an unspoiled barrier island just offshore from the mouth of
the Apalachicola River in the Gulf of Mexico. The island is a haven
for endangered and threatened species, including bald eagles, wood
storks, sea turtles, indigo snakes, gopher tortoises and red wolves.
It is accessible only by boat. A favorite is Wakulla Springs State
Park, one of the world's deepest freshwater springs, with swimming,
nature boat rides and glass bottom boats. Wakulla Springs is known as
the shooting location for several Tarzan movies, Creature from the
Black Lagoon and Airport �77. From the river boat and glass bottom
boat tours, you can see alligators, many species of wading birds,
water fowl, fish, turtles, and snakes, in and among the crystal clear
waters emerging from the depth of the springs. Kids love diving from
the diving platform into the refreshing spring waters, which remain a
constant 68-70 degrees year round. The St. Marks National Wildlife
Refuge features the St. Marks Lighthouse, and offers a habitat for
all kinds of Florida wildlife. (Bald eagles are often spotted here -
so keep your eyes peeled!)
So the guys want to take in some of the finest deep sea or flats
fishing in Florida; NO PROBLEM, LADIES! While they are catching
speckled trout, Spanish mackerel, grouper, redfish (the list goes
on), you can visit historic Apalachicola. Once a bustling sea port,
this quaint village of about 5,000 still boasts a large shrimp fleet,
a downtown shopping area with antiques, boutiques and local art, and
beautiful restored houses from a bygone era. Once the third largest
cotton port along the Gulf Coast, the Apalachicola/East Point area
still harvests and processes 90% of the oysters consumed in Florida.
Locally caught seafood is prepared in the many fine restaurants
located in Panacea, Carrabelle, and Apalachicola. If you prefer to
cook it yourself, fresh shrimp, oysters, and the catch of the day are
available in the seafood houses dotted along the coast from Panacea
to Port St. Joe.
